Family Lawyer - Wiltshire - Full or Part Time

Join a well established, multi office regional firm with a strong reputation across Wiltshire for high quality private client and family work. Recognised in Legal 500 and Chambers, the firm combines modern working practices with a strong client focused ethos.

With several offices across Wiltshire, the firm is flexible on the office location for this role, depending on your specialism.

The Role
You will manage a high value, complex family law caseload, including:

  • Financial remedy matters involving substantial and multi jurisdictional assets
  • International relocation
  • Off shore structures and trusts
  • Cases regularly exceeding £10m


You'll work within a growing, ambitious team and contribute to a forward thinking practice investing in technology, innovation and long term strategic development.

Candidate Requirements

  • Experience across the full range of family law: divorce, finances, children, injunctions, nuptial agreements
  • Ability to handle complex, sensitive and high value matters with confidence
  • Strong client care skills and sound judgement
  • Collaborative, commercially aware and keen to contribute to team growth
  • Comfortable working flexibly while maintaining high professional standards
